Subject: DR Drill Friday — Config Hot-Reload

Welcome, new folks. Friday's drill tests hot-reloading configuration on the Bramblewick edge tier: we push a bad config, watch the reloader reject it, then roll forward cleanly. No restarts expected. To unlock the drill vault, use the recovery passphrase provided below.

unlock words, fafop-hawep: briwyn-oliix-sorox

Alert: Fareloom rules engine — rule evaluation latency above threshold. Shipping fee calculations are falling back to flat-rate defaults, which may misquote customers at checkout. Likely causes: oversized rule set after a release, or cache invalidation storm. Hold further rule deployments until latency recovers. Rollback steps and the release gating checklist are documented on this page.

wiki page, tahaf-tajog: https://jira.ordindyn.corp/pipeline

Ticket: Missed pick-up — uniform consignment, Redlarch Depot. The scheduled collection of new staff uniforms from Tollan Workwear did not occur Tuesday; the driver reported the bay closed. Consignment remains at the supplier dock. Please reschedule for the next available slot and confirm with the depot opening team. When the replacement courier arrives, they must be given this instruction at hand-over:

dispatch memo: the eliath belael courier leaves the praox ledger at gate 8841 under passcode 017589

For the weekly eng sync: the Ledgerline import wizard silently discards rows where a quoted field contains the configured delimiter. Affected customers see row counts lower than their source files with no warning surfaced. Parsing falls back to naive split when the streaming parser hits a malformed quote pair mid-chunk. Proposed fix: buffer across chunk boundaries and emit a per-row error instead of discarding. Repro files are attached. The failing build is identified by the token below.

trace token, fafog-kageg: htk4_98e6